access and core network in 5G.
Wireless access: Elte and Nr.
Core network: 4G core network EPC and 5G core network.
The 5G core network is called next Generation core (NGCN).
In the first phase of 5G, Elte and NR will be used and shared with the 4G core network EPC. Then, as the network slowly evolves, NR will be plugged into its own core network NGCN, which could occur in the second phase of 5G.

TAILTE/EPC identifies the user location with a Tai, similar to the 2g/3g location area Lai and the routing area Rai, a TA can be composed of one or more cells. When the Tai change occurs in the LTE user movement, the terminal needs to initiate a Tau tracking zone update to the Mme, which contains the user's Tai.Tai is made up of three parts of Mcc+mnc+tac. The electronic coding structure of RFID tags mainly includesEPCCoding SystemAndUID CenterCoding System.
EPCThe full name is electronic product code. The Chinese name is product electronics.Code. EPC is the only electronic code assigned to an item. Its length is usually 64-bit or 96-bit, and can also be expanded to 256-bit. Different encoding formats are required for different applications.
